Definitions

(verb) surround with a cloister, as of a garden. Synonyms: cloister.
· ·
Verb Definition 1
(verb) surround with a cloister. Synonyms: cloister. Example: "Cloister the garden."
· ·
Verb Definition 2
(verb) seclude from the world in or as if in a cloister. Synonyms: cloister. Example: "She cloistered herself in the office."
· ·
Verb Definition 3
(adj) of communal life sequestered from the world under religious vows. Synonyms: cloistral, conventual, monastic, monastical.
· ·
Adjective Definition 1
(adj) providing privacy or seclusion. Synonyms: reclusive, secluded, sequestered. Examples: "The cloistered academic world of books." "Sat close together in the sequestered pergola." "Sitting under the reclusive calm of a shade tree." "A secluded romantic spot."
